AJKLTF holds virtual meet on Research Paper competition

Excelsior Correspondent

JAMMU, May 1:An online meeting  under the banner of All Jammu Kashmir and Ladakh Teachers Federation (AJKLTF) got organised under the chairmanship of All  India organising secretary of ABRSM Mahendra Kapoor .
He highlighted the basic purpose of organising such competition and said that this will serve as a platform for the teaching community at school education level and higher level to explore new ideas and finally an amalgam of ideas would be created. The topics for research paper at school level participants are Inculcating the Spirit of Ek Bharat Shreshth Bharat through Education, Effectiveness of online teaching, Holistic development of children ;role of mother tongue and Implementation of new education policy 2020 opportunities and challenges.
Kapoor further briefed the participants about the registration process and said that anyone desirous to participate in this competition need to register himself or herself through online Google form by paying a token money of Rs 100. They can write the paper in Hindi or English or any regional language of their choice and the word limit is 3000 to 5000 words and the last date for submission of paper is May 31,he added.
He said that the first prize is of Rs. 21,000, second is of 15,000, and third is of Rs11,000 and  seven consolation prizes of Rs. 5100 each for this competition. He appealed to all affiliated organisations to take up this as a challenge and pen down their innovative ideas without copying and pasting and submit the same through the Google form.
All the Zonal, District and State level office bearers participated in the meeting and showed a keen interest in the forthcoming national level event-Essay competition-2021.
Dev Raj Thakur state president assured the maximum participation of teachers from J&K in upcoming “Essay Competition”. Rattan Sharma State general secretary also assured of providing all possible services to the society during this pandemic.
